Security If you're renting a shipping container for work, using it to store your possessions on an employment site, or using one as a tiny home security is a crucial factor to take into. Luckily, 6ft shipping containers are built to be secure and can protect against theft and unauthorized access. The standard doors on a shipping container are fitted with high-security locks that make them virtually impossible to break. Some companies offer shipping containers that have been modified with doors that are stronger to offer greater security for your equipment and goods. In addition to the lock on the container you are shipping to it is a good idea to invest in a strong-duty padlock that is specifically designed for use on containers. These locks feature shackles that are more robust, which are harder to cut than regular padlocks. Secure your container by aligning the shackle the loop. Installing a lockbox is another method to enhance the security of your shipping container. These metal housings are attached to the doors of the shipping container and are used to protect and cover the padlock. This makes it difficult for burglars or other criminals to cut the lock. In fact most of the containers offered for sale or hired by Unit Hire come with these secure lock boxes that are already in place. Also, you should consider installing an alarm system on your shipping container. It's a simple and effective deterrent, which will sound an alarm at a high pitch if someone attempts to break in. Certain alarm systems also notify the owner of the container in case there any suspicious activity occurring around it, thereby providing a substantial amount of additional protection for your products and equipment. Weatherproof The same qualities which make shipping containers safe at sea also allow them to withstand severe weather conditions. They are wind- and water-proof, resistant to dust and snow, and can maintain the integrity of their structure even in difficult environments.
